		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Depends on what you are doing. The CULV (+ 4500 MHD) is going to be better for processor intensive applications. Like zipping files, flash video, and spreadsheet calulations. And the Atom+ Ion is going to be better at games and hardware excellerated HD video (though I think the Acer could handle that, check the review). THe Aton should also have much better battery life.</p>
